Block Matching Algorithm Based on RANSAC Algorithm

A new type of real-time image stabilization system is introduced in present paper. RANSAC Algorithm is used in the system. The accuracy and speed of image stabilization is improved effectively. A low-cost and high-performance solution of real-time digital image stabilization system is given in this paper. Video stabilization working principle is discussed and the moving image mathematical model is set up. The RANSAC algorithm can reduce the amount of calculation and the error rate of block matching. Simulation of the real-time image stabilization system is accomplished. The result shows the new model is effective; the power SNR of the video is raised about 8-10dB.
